About the Role
The Junior IT Support role at Staff Solutions provides day-to-day technical support to users, assisting with maintaining the organisation’s IT systems. This position is suitable for a junior candidate eager to learn and develop within an IT environment.
Key Responsibilities
- Provide first-line IT support to users for hardware, software, and network-related issues.
- Assist with troubleshooting desktop computers, printers, email, and general office applications.
- Install, configure, and maintain user workstations and peripheral devices.
- Assist users with email setup, password resets, and system access requests.
- Assist with basic database administration tasks, primarily within SQL environments.
- Support database maintenance activities, including backups, monitoring, and basic troubleshooting.
- Help maintain data integrity and system performance.
- Provide basic support for company servers and assist with routine maintenance tasks.
- Monitor system performance and escalate issues when required.
- Assist senior IT staff with server updates, backups, and system checks.
- Assist with managing and tracking software licenses across the organisation.
- Support the installation and updating of business software applications.
- Maintain IT asset registers and system documentation.
- Log and track IT support requests and ensure timely resolution.
- Maintain accurate records of IT systems, licenses, and equipment.
- Provide general support to the IT team on projects and daily operations.
Requirements
- Relevant IT qualification (Diploma, Certificate, or Degree in Information Technology or similar).
- Basic knowledge of computer hardware, operating systems, and networking.
- Basic understanding of SQL databases will be advantageous.
- Familiarity with Microsoft Office and email systems.
- Strong problem-solving and communication skills.
- Willingness to learn and develop technical skills.
